Section 4 describes digital techniques that are used to compute crosscorrelation and crossspectral density functions. Powerspectraldensity analysis technical knowledge base. Cross spectrum and magnitudesquared coherence matlab. It is generally used for nonfinite energy signals mostly not limited in time signals, who arent squaresummable. This example shows how to use the cross spectrum to obtain the phase lag between sinusoidal components in a bivariate time series. Estimate spectral density of a time series from ar fit. The signals psd is the autocorrelation of the signals fourier transform, as stated by the wienerkhinchin theorem. Furthermore, the probability density function of this spectral density matrix estimator for a general stationary stochastic vector process as n. Cross spectral density is the same, but using crosscorrelation, so one can find the power shared by a given frequency for the two. Power spectral density psd analysis is an important part of understanding lineedge and linewidth roughness in lithography. The true twosided spectral energy density function suu f is the fourier transform of the true. I realize it is easy to fix, but you have it all through the pdf files, a sample would save 20. Effectively it is a meansquare value over a band width of your interest. When a signal is defined in terms only of a voltage, for instance, there is no unique power associated with the stated amplitude.
Estimate spectral density of a time series from ar fit description. Use the following in the subject row, assignment 3 by tpi07xyz one student. Pdf in this paper the crosspower spectral density function and the cross correlation function are reconstructed by the complex fractional spectral. Fits an ar model to x or uses the existing fit and computes and by default plots the spectral density of the fitted model. The same with two different time series will give you cross spectral density. If two signals both possess power spectral densities, then the cross spectral. This paper briefly explains psd analysis and methods of presenting the results. Calculate auto spectral density and cross spectral density.
Crossspectral density an overview sciencedirect topics. If xt and yt are measured in volts, s xx f and s yy f will have units of volts 2 per hertz, while t has units of seconds. S xx f, s yy f and s xy f always exist for finitelength. The power spectrum is a plot of the power, or variance, of a time series as a function of the frequency1. Has anyone seen a code for the cross power spectral density function it exists in matlab, but i would rather not use matlab for obvious reasons. The example also uses the magnitudesquared coherence to identify significant frequencydomain correlation at the sine wave frequencies. Introduction to spectral analysis university of washington. Analysis methods for multispacecraft data international space. The firstorder probability density functions of the random variables x t x t defined for all time t will be denoted by f x x t t or. Cross power spectral density from individual power. Seismic noise analysis system using power spectral density. A new look at an old tool the cumulative spectral power. Cross power spectral density matlab cpsd mathworks.
Autocovariance generating function and spectral density. Pdf in this paper the crosspower spectral density function and the crosscorrelation function are reconstructed by the complex fractional spectral. Power spectral density is commonly expressed in watts per hertz whz. Powerspectraldensitydata, \omega estimates the power spectral density for data.
It is also proved that for such a process, the spectral. The probability density function pdf is a measure of the intensity of the probability at a point dpdx. If you specify fs, the corresponding intervals are 0,fs2 cyclesunit time for even nfft and 0. Does cross power spectral density has anything to do with power distribution like power spectral density or. Parametric estimation of the crosspower spectral density. Signal processing stack exchange is a question and answer site for practitioners of the art and science of signal, image and video processing. Cross power spectral density cross power spectral density. Dpsd displacement power spectral density vpsd velocity power spectral density apsd acceleration power spectral density note that each psd function is a function of the frequency f.
How to get the power spectral density from a spectrogram. Geological survey openfile report, we detail the methods and installation procedures for a standalone noise analysis software package. No w, crossco v ariance of a signal is giv en b y x 1 2 n 1 x l 1 x 1 l 2 7. Is it stored in the variable s considering i used the line. If two signals both possess power spectral densities, then the crossspectral. More systematic errors in the measurement of power spectral density chris a. Spectral analysis is the process of estimating the power spectrum ps of a signal from its timedomain representation. Powerspectral density is the distribution of power along the frequency axis.
I exluded the possbility to calculate the confidential interval. To obtain a time deviation, the input signal is repeti tively sampled, acquiring a distribution of points at a horizontal crosssection. The spectral density functions s xx f and s yy f are positive, realvalued even functions of f. Properties of the power spectral density introduction as we could see from the derivation of wienerkhinthine theorem the power spectral density psd is just another way of looking at the second order statistics of a random process. The power spectral density psd of the signal describes the power present in the signal as a function of frequency, per unit frequency. Discrete powerspectral density functions we will consider two ways to compute discrete auto and crossspectral density functions from our discrete data series. I think that i need the matrix of numbers used by matlab to generate the spectrogram. Discrete spectral density from fourier transforms of covariance functions. Introduction to spectral analysis donpercival,appliedphysicslab, universityofwashington q. Seismic noise analysis system using power spectral density probability density functionsa standalone software package by d. A power spectral density psd analysis of a road profile, however, can give more detailed information about the pavement surface, including roughness information for specific longitudinal wavelengths. Pdf the crossspectrum experimental method researchgate.
Spectral density estimation of stochastic vector processes. It applies the window specified by the window vector to each successive section of input x. What is the difference between using cross spectrum and. Now i would like to calculate the coherence or the normalized cross spectral density to estimate if there is any causality between the input and output to find out on which frequencies this coherence appear. More systematic errors in the measurement of power. On genuine crossspectral density matrices article pdf available in journal of optics a pure and applied optics 118. The examples show you how to properly scale the output of fft for evenlength inputs, for normalized frequency and hertz, and for one and twosided psd estimates. In the figure i have uploaded for example, is there a function to get the power spectral density of the signal between 1 2 hz. Ive two signals, from which i expect that one is responding on the other, but with a certain phase shift. Risley national bureau of standards boulder, colorado 80302 usa summary stability in the frequency domain is commonly speci fied in terms of spectral densities. The general equation which describes the voltage or current noise spectral density in the 1f region is. If cl can be inverted, then the solution can be written as x. The resulting relationships for the power spectral density functions are shown in tables 4 and 5. The sine multitapers are used, and the number of tapers varies with spectral shape, according to the optimal value proposed by riedel and sidorenko 1995.
Tutorial by tom irvine, july 28, 2000 pdf obtain the psd function from random vibration timehistory data using a bandpass filtering method. This example shows how to obtain nonparametric power spectral density psd estimates equivalent to the periodogram using fft. Normally, one supposes that statistically significant peaks at the same frequency have been shown in two time series and that we wish to see. Test of coherence and phase lag calculations using the mystery time series provided by bill lavelle the goal of this exercise is to determine the coherence and phase lag functions for these 2 time series using matlab functions, and thereby gain some confidence in their application to natural time series. It is possible to use a onesided definition but then special precautions have to be taken in defining the value at dc and in handling this value during taking computations. A method for the estimation of the significance of crosscorrelations. Psd since the psd function is intended to present the power spectral density, as described by the name, the units of the psd function will naturally be watthz kgm2s3hz or wattkghz m2s3hz in the seismometers case if the mass of the instrument is scaled out to produce what is called the specific power spectral density spsd. If gf is the fourier transform, then the power spectrum, wf, can be computed as. Thus, the process fx tgis an endogenous solution to the di. The average cross power spectral density converges to the dut power spectral density. Computer exercise 3 in stationary stochastic processes, ht 17. The cross spectral density is the fourier transform of the cross correlation function. Cross spectral density is the same, but using cross correlation, so you can find the power shared by a given frequency for the two signals using its squared module, and the phase shift between the two signals at that frequency using its argument. Frequency domain specification and measurement of signal stability donald halford, john h.
A spectral density matrix estimator is defined based on a finite number, n, of data points which takes care of aliasing and leakage effects automatically. The shape of the powerspectraldensity input function is dependent upon the probability of loading for each frequency, and the variation in likely load magnitude as a function of its frequency. Browse other questions tagged autocorrelation autoregressive proof spectralanalysis or ask your own question. If it is required, please leave a comment and i will update the necessary dependencies. Hence the integration of the pdf x over the whole domain x is equal to 1 the sum of all. The file is based on matlabs implementation using the signal processing toolbox. C hapter 4 p o w er sp ectral d ensi ty dalhousie university. Section 3 describes analog techniques that are used to compute both tlhe crossspectral density and the crosscorrelation function. The cross correlation is the ensemble average of the timeshifted product of xt and yt, and if these are independent zeromean processes than the ensemble average is the product of the two means is zero, thus making the cross spectral density zero. This method enables the extraction of the dut noise spectrum, even if it. For example, the cross spectral density can be negative as well as positive, and an imaginary component can be defined and measured also. Mack, 1605 watchhill road, austin, texas 78703, united states abstract.
The fundamentals of fftbased signal analysis and measurement pdf. What links here related changes upload file special pages permanent link. We note there is a greater possible complexity in the cross spectral density concept than in the auto spectral density concept. Relation of spectral density to the fourier transform o weinerkhinchine relationship. This matlab function estimates the cross power spectral density cpsd of two discretetime signals, x and y, using welchs averaged, modified periodogram. Powerspectraldensitydata, \omega, sspec estimates the power spectral density for data with smoothing specification sspec. Timefrequency analysis of timevarying signals and non. Lets prove that the fourier transform of the autocorrelation function does indeed equal to the power spectral density of. Psd is the distribution of power along the frequency axis.
304 240 661 1253 702 365 1335 622 332 1587 874 1350 77 735 68 353 1305 771 846 471 770 1183 1213 1250 1549 146 1468 931 367 397 430 847 179 808 399 1149